New Greyhounds Antepost Favourite For Michael Fortune Memorial Plate

There’s a new antepost favourite to win the BoyleSports Michael Fortune Memorial Derby Plate after a brilliant quarter-final victory.

The Peter Cronin trained Kildare, the talented son of Droopys Sydney – Palermo, was fast away from trap six and obliged for favourite backers at a generous price of 2/1 beating Sunshine Dream by five lengths in 29.40.

The sponsors have cut Kildare into 11/4 from 5/1 making him the new favourite.

Garryvoe Joe has caught the eye over the last few weeks for trainer Graham Holland. This son of Dorotas Wildcat – Jalingo has just six career starts on his card so the future is looking bright.

He won the opening heat by a short head to the speedy Bobsleigh Dream in 29.68. Garryvoe 6/1 from 14/1 and Bobsleigh is 8/1 from 10/1 in the betting.

Ballymac Joey was the winner in heat three in 29.62 for trainer Liam Dowling beating his kennelmate Ballymac Ben by two and a half lengths. This son of Ballymac Bolger is now 12/1 from 33/1 with Ben 14/1 from 20/1.

Emilys Jet was in impressive winner of heat two for trainer Peter Cronin in 29.74 and is 14/1 from 33/1 to win the title.

Sarah Kinsella, spokesperson for BoyleSports, said: “We are down the semi-final stage of the Michael Fortune Memorial Derby Plate with Kildare our new favourite.

We cut him into 11/4 from 5/1 after his quarterfinal victory and looks to be coming into his top form at the right time.

Garryvoe Joe looks an exciting prospect for Graham Holland with his chances cut into 6/1 from 14/1.”
